An AI-generated version of Seinfeld called Nothing Forever was released to the public in mid-December.
It followed four characters named Kakler, Larry, Fred, and Yvonne. After its release, the show continued to stream on Twitch 24/7. However, now the show is banned because of what happened.
Xander, one of the shows creators, said they are appealing the ban. According to Fox News, Hey everybody. Heres the latest: we received a 14-day suspension due to what Larry Feinberg said tonight during a club bit, Xander reportedly said. Weve appealed the ban, and well let you know as we know more about what Twitch decides. Regardless of the outcome of the appeal, well be back and will spend the time working to ensure to the best of our abilities that nothing like that happens again.
No one has specified what caused the ban. However, many think its because of Larrys comments during a stand-up comedy routine. They are considered transphobic, and, more than likely, quite a few people were offended.
During the routine, Larry says that he notices no one is laughing and says hes thinking of doing a few bits about transgender being a mental illness or that liberals are all gay. Larry then made a statement about perhaps including that transgender people are ruining the fabric of society.
The shows staff have called it technical issues with the AI. Twitch says it violated community standards and guidelines. Some people were in disbelief that an AI could be offensive to people.

The show is banned from Twitch for at least 14 days for violating the policies, and they have yet to announce when it will be re-instated.
